IRR Participation Requirements
Per MCRAMM Chapter 8 and Chapter 4 Section 2.2, IRR members maintain specific participation requirements.
Annual Muster
Per 10 USC 1020610 USC 10206.
- Annual screening contact with member
- Verify member status and contact information
- Update readiness data
- Earn membership points (15 per anniversary year)
Current Address
- Member must maintain current address with HQMC/MCRSC
- Address updates via MOL
- Annual verification through muster

IRR Membership Points
Per MCRAMM Chapter 4.
15 Points Per Anniversary Year
Members earn membership points for IRR status.
- Counts toward retirement satisfactory year
- Combined with active duty days for total points
- Specific calculation per anniversary year
Earning Membership Points
Member earns points by maintaining IRR participation requirements.
- Annual muster completion
- Address maintenance
- DEERS and SGLI current
Not Sufficient for Satisfactory Year
15 points alone is not enough for satisfactory year.
- 50 points minimum for satisfactory year
- Member must combine with other point sources for satisfactory year
- IRR alone might not produce satisfactory years
